Checklist item 7: Confirm the Lanternjaw crash-report pipeline strips device serials and user handles before reports leave the app, and that the scrubber version matches the one audited last cycle. Verify sampling config was not widened during the branch cut. Sign-off requires matching the audited artifact against the build token shown immediately below this item.

pipeline stamp: htk31_f769b577b3028a4e9958e5bb8d1259a

Subject: Handover — Bouncewright release duties

Hi Tamsin,

Welcome aboard. You'll own releases for Bouncewright, our email bounce processor at Ferndale Systems. Cut releases from the stable branch only, run the suppression-list regression suite first, and confirm the DSN parser fixtures pass on both worker pools. Staging soak is 24 hours minimum, no exceptions. All release artifacts must be signed before the deploy job will accept them.

rollout seal: bky4_x7Gc

**Handover: Striderlap Chip Reader**

Taking over from me means owning the timing-chip reader array used at the Fennbrook Marathon. The readers poll every 40 ms; mat three drops packets in heavy rain, so the dedupe job in the ingest service matters. Firmware updates go out only between race seasons — never mid-event. Logs rotate weekly to the archive volume. The calibration suite lives in the tools repo under /striderlap. To decrypt the stored calibration profiles on a fresh machine, supply the passphrase that follows.

vault phrase of tawef-fahap = holax-belox-ulamir-holiel-lamwyn-oliius-jorix-casion-quenius-fraeth-casir-belax-kelox

## Further reading

The Tallowmere fleet fuel-usage report aggregates nightly from the Droverline telemetry pipeline. If numbers look off, check pipeline lag first — the report silently renders stale data. Common causes: missed ingestion windows, odometer resets, and the known double-count bug on split shifts. Schema notes, lag thresholds, and the recompute procedure are maintained on the internal page below.

wiki page, tahaf-tajog: https://jira.ordindyn.corp/pipeline